Analyzing the Tensile Strength of Fabrics in Solid Color Comforter Sets

The tensile strength of fabrics used in solid color comforter sets is a crucial factor in determining their durability and overall quality. This article will explore the importance of tensile strength in the textile industry, the methods used to measure it, and how it impacts the longevity and performance of comforter sets.

Understanding Tensile Strength in Textiles
Tensile strength refers to the maximum force a fabric can withstand before breaking or tearing. It is a key indicator of a fabric's durability and is especially important in bedding products like comforter sets that are subject to daily use and frequent laundering.
Material Composition: The tensile strength of a fabric is influenced by its fiber content, yarn construction, and weave type. For solid color comforter sets, commonly used materials include cotton, polyester, bamboo fiber, and linen, each offering different tensile strengths.
Weave Density: The weave density, or thread count, also plays a significant role. Higher thread counts often result in stronger fabrics, but the quality of the yarn and the weaving process are equally important.

Methods of Measuring Tensile Strength
In the textile industry, tensile strength is measured using standardized tests that apply force to a fabric sample until it breaks. The results are expressed in units of force (usually Newtons) and provide valuable data on the fabric's strength.
Strip Test Method: This common test involves cutting a strip of fabric and applying force until it breaks. The maximum force applied before the fabric breaks is recorded as the tensile strength.
Grab Test Method: In this method, a larger portion of the fabric is gripped, and force is applied. It simulates the conditions where fabric might be pulled or stretched in use, providing a more practical measure of tensile strength.

Impact of Tensile Strength on Comforter Sets
For solid color comforter sets, high tensile strength ensures that the fabric can withstand the stresses of daily use without tearing or fraying. This is particularly important in settings like hotels or high-end residences where bedding undergoes frequent laundering.
Longevity: Fabrics with higher tensile strength are less likely to wear out quickly, making them ideal for long-term use in comforter sets.
Resistance to Damage: High tensile strength also means that the comforter set is more resistant to accidental damage, such as tearing during use or washing.

Factors Affecting Tensile Strength in Comforter Fabrics
Several factors can influence the tensile strength of fabrics used in solid color comforter sets, including:
Fiber Quality: High-quality fibers, whether natural or synthetic, contribute to stronger fabrics. The processing and treatment of these fibers also play a role.
Dyeing and Finishing Processes: The methods used to dye and finish the fabric can affect its tensile strength. For instance, some dyeing processes may weaken fibers, while others may enhance the fabric's durability.

The tensile strength of fabrics is a critical factor in the design and production of solid color comforter sets. By understanding and optimizing tensile strength, manufacturers can ensure that their products are not only aesthetically pleasing but also durable and long-lasting. This focus on quality contributes to the overall value and satisfaction for end-users, making tensile strength analysis an essential part of textile manufacturing.

Thermal Properties of Solid Color Comforter Fabrics

The thermal properties of fabrics used in solid color comforter sets are essential for ensuring comfort and effective temperature regulation. Understanding these properties can help in selecting the right comforter for different climates and personal preferences. This article explores the key thermal characteristics of comforter fabrics and their impact on sleep quality.

Understanding Thermal Properties in Bedding Fabrics
Thermal properties refer to a fabric's ability to manage heat and maintain a comfortable sleeping environment. Key aspects include insulation, breathability, and heat retention.
Insulation: This measures how well a fabric can trap heat and provide warmth. Effective insulation prevents heat from escaping, keeping the sleeper warm in colder conditions.
Breathability: This property determines how well a fabric allows air to flow through, which helps in dissipating heat and moisture. Good breathability ensures that the fabric does not overheat or become uncomfortable during sleep.
Heat Retention: This refers to the fabric’s ability to retain warmth over time. Fabrics with high heat retention properties are beneficial in maintaining a consistent and comfortable temperature throughout the night.

Key Fabrics and Their Thermal Properties
Different materials used in solid color comforter sets offer varying thermal properties:
Cotton: Known for its breathability and moderate insulation, cotton comforters are ideal for all-season use. They offer good heat retention while allowing air circulation, making them suitable for both cool and warm climates.
Polyester: This synthetic fabric provides excellent insulation and is often used in comforters designed for colder environments. Polyester comforters typically offer high heat retention but may be less breathable than natural fibers.
Bamboo Fiber: Bamboo is praised for its natural breathability and moisture-wicking properties. It provides moderate insulation and excellent temperature regulation, making it suitable for a wide range of temperatures.
Linen: Linen is highly breathable and offers good heat dissipation. While it provides less insulation than other fabrics, its breathability helps keep the sleeper cool in warmer conditions.

Impact of Fabric Weight on Thermal Properties
The weight of a comforter fabric can significantly affect its thermal performance:
Lightweight Fabrics: Generally provide less insulation and are suited for warmer climates or summer use. They offer good breathability but may not provide sufficient warmth in cold conditions.
Heavyweight Fabrics: Offer better insulation and are ideal for colder climates or winter use. These fabrics retain heat more effectively but may be less breathable, potentially leading to overheating if not properly ventilated.

Advanced Textile Technologies
Innovative technologies in textile manufacturing enhance the thermal properties of comforter fabrics:
Thermoregulatory Treatments: Some fabrics are treated with thermoregulating agents that help maintain a consistent temperature by adjusting to body heat and external conditions.
High-Performance Insulation: Modern comforters may include specialized insulating materials that enhance warmth without adding bulk, improving both comfort and thermal efficiency.

The thermal properties of solid color comforter fabrics play a crucial role in determining the comfort and effectiveness of bedding. By understanding factors such as insulation, breathability, and heat retention, consumers can select comforters that best meet their needs and preferences. Whether opting for natural fibers like cotton and bamboo or synthetic options like polyester, the choice of fabric will significantly influence the sleeping experience, ensuring comfort across different seasons and climates.
